We are thrilled to see that you are interested in beginning your career with the Ohio Department of Rehabilitation and Correction! Without a doubt, this will be the most rewarding and meaningful work you'll ever find with a work family that is second to none!What You'll DoMaintain control of the institution to provide safety and security of the facility, inmates, staff, and general public by enforcing rules, regulations, policies, and procedures.Supervise and direct inmate activity in assigned areas of the facility.Assure the assigned area is clean, safe, and secure.Monitor and operate security controls, equipment, and computers.Operate automotive vehicles for perimeter security and transportation of inmates.Conduct inmate counts, security rounds, and searches.Complete required reports and serve on committees.Prevent escapes or incidents that threaten security.Use physical force, unarmed self‑defense, firearms, or other force to detain or secure inmates when necessary.QualificationsHigh school diploma or G.E.D.; must have a valid driver's license for transportation positions, or a commercial driver's license if required to operate commercial vehicles.Pass the Correction Officer Assessment or have successfully completed the assessment within the past 24 months.Current employees of the Ohio Department of Rehabilitation and Correction who have been certified as a correction officer also qualify.Probationary period of 365 days.CompensationStep 1 salary $24.88 per hour, increasing to $25.61 after six months. An additional $0.60 per hour is earned for working 2nd or 3rd shift.LocationToledo Correctional Institution, Lucas County, Ohio.#J-18808-Ljbffr
